Florida charter school cleared to teach
Hebrew, but other challenges remain
Larry Luxner

Students in uniform at Ben Gamla Charter School.  The Jewish-oriented charter school has received permission to move ahead with its Hebrew classes.

 

The Ben Gamla Charter School has received permission to move ahead with its Hebrew classes. Now it can start addressing its other challenges -- like how to get the air conditioning working.
